How To Fix /ISDFPS/MISC676 - Enter an equip. package, material planning object, or material container


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/ISDFPS/MISC -

  • Message number: 676

  • Message text: Enter an equip. package, material planning object, or material container

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message /ISDFPS/MISC676 - Enter an equip. package, material planning object, or material container ?

    The SAP error message /ISDFPS/MISC676 indicates that the system requires an equipment package, material planning object, or material container to be specified in the context of a specific transaction or process. This error typically arises in scenarios related to logistics, inventory management, or production planning where the system expects a reference to a physical object or container that holds materials.

    Cause:

    1. Missing Input: The user did not provide the necessary input for equipment package, material planning object, or material container.
    2. Incorrect Configuration: The system may not be properly configured to recognize the required objects.
    3. Data Integrity Issues: There may be issues with the master data, such as missing or incorrect entries for equipment or containers.
    4. Transaction Context: The transaction being executed may require specific parameters that were not filled in.

    Solution:

    1. Check Input Fields: Ensure that you have filled in all required fields in the transaction. Look for fields related to equipment package, material planning object, or material container.
    2. Verify Master Data: Check the master data for the relevant equipment, containers, or planning objects to ensure they are correctly defined and active in the system.
    3. Consult Documentation: Review the documentation for the specific transaction you are using to understand what inputs are required.
    4. System Configuration: If you have access, check the configuration settings in the SAP system to ensure that the necessary objects are defined and available for use.
    5. User Authorization: Ensure that you have the necessary authorizations to access and use the required objects in the system.
    6. Contact Support: If the issue persists,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or consulting with an SAP expert for further assistance.
